Woolner NT

Postcode 0820 · Darwin LGA

Woolner is a small community in Northern Territory within the Darwin local government area (postcode 0820). With a population of 962, the suburb has a mix of young professionals and families with a median age of 34. Households earn a median income of $137K per year, with an average household size of 2.4 people. The most common occupations are professionals, community & personal service, managers. The top ancestries reported are Australian, English, Irish.

The median house price in Woolner is $788,000, having dipped slightly 2.7% over the past year. Units have a median price of $420,000 (-2.3% YoY). The median weekly rent is $440 (Census 2021). This gives a gross rental yield of approximately 2.9%. The median monthly mortgage repayment is $1,950.

Public transport access includes 1 bus stop.

From an investment perspective, Woolner offers a gross rental yield of 2.9%, rated as low yield. Property prices are near the state median ($788K/$711K). The price-to-income ratio of 5.8x is considered affordable. House prices have moved -2.7% year-on-year.
